  • Publication number: 20170212198
    Abstract: For the purpose of effectively suppressing shading generated in an image due to B1 inhomogeneity, there are performed an acquiring step of acquiring magnetic resonance signals simultaneously received at a body coil and a surface coil; a filtering step of applying image-based filtering for suppressing shading due to B1 inhomogeneity to a first image according to received signals from the body coil; a calculating step of calculating a sensitivity of the surface coil based on the image-based-filtered first image and a second image according to received signals from the surface coil; and a correcting step of correcting sensitivity unevenness in the second image using the sensitivity.

  • Publication number: 20150094563
    Abstract: A magnetic resonance system configured to repeatedly execute imaging sequences each having a first RF pulse for flipping each spin in a region containing blood, and a data acquisition sequence acquiring data of the blood from the region is provided. The magnetic resonance system includes a storage unit configured to store a correspondence relation between a contrast between the blood and a background tissue, a first time taken from the first RF pulse to the data acquisition sequence, and a second time taken from a completion of an imaging sequence to a start of a next imaging sequence, first determining means configured to determine the first time used, and second determining means configured to determine the second time used.

  • Patent number: 7679363
    Abstract: With the objective of eliminating variations in signal strength, there is provided a magnetic resonance imaging apparatus in which the process of 90°-exciting and 180°-exciting spins of two slices intersecting each other respectively and receiving a spin echo generated from an intersection thereof is repeated while the intersection is sequentially parallel-moved to a plurality of lines, thereby to generate, based on the received spin echo, a two-dimensional image at the time that the plural lines are seen in a projection direction. In the magnetic resonance imaging apparatus, the lines are set at a matrix in which a phase direction is defined as a row direction and the projection direction is defined as a column direction. A plurality of the lines at which a predetermined number of column intervals are defined as mutual intervals are set in the respective rows. One line is set to each column.
